The Effect of Acoustic Pressure and Cavitation on the Secondary Nucleation of Ice
In order to clarify the mechanism of secondary nucleation of iceinduced by ultrasound, experiments on ice crystals in degassed sucrose solutions and untreated solutions have been carried out using a novel ultrasonic cold stage device.
